U.S.Flag   Private services for Elda Nyle Dunton, 69, of Spur were held Sunday, April 18, 1999 under the direction of Campbell Funeral Home of Spur.

Mr. Dunton died Friday, April 16, 1999 in Lubbock Methodist Hospital. He was born October 9, 1929 in Grand Island, Nebraska. He was a U.S. Navy veteran and served in the Korean War. He married Rosemary Powell April 20, 1962 in Boise, Idaho. They moved to Spur in 1985 from California. He was a retired house painter.

He was preceded in death by one son, Donald in 1981.

He is survived by his wife; four sons, Robert H. Dunton, St. Petersburg, Florida; Carl R. Dunton, North Platte, Nebraska; Dewaine Dunton, Sweetwater; Randy D. Dunton, Spur; two daughter, Val Rendon, Spur; and Helen Bennett, Lovington, NM; two brothers, Rodney Dunton, Idaho; Mervin Dunton, Utah; 14 grandchildren and five great grandchildren.

©The Texas Spur, April 22, 1999
